  • How Long Before We Have Another Einstein?

    EINSTEIN LIKE MOST GENIUS IS A PRODUCT OF THE OPPORTUNITY TO COALESCE DISPARATE INSIGHTS IN A PARTICULAR BODY OF TIME.

    1) It certainly appears that Einstein merely provided mathematical tests for work of Poincare. (Almost everything else he said, did, and wrote was really.. quite silly.). The genius was provided by Maxwell and Poincare. Einstein’s elegance was in his method of communication.

    2) The evidence suggests (see Murray) that we obtain a genius in a field because two prior generations of intellectuals concentrate efforts in that field for status seeking reasons. (Mozart).

    3) It also appears that a certain rate of wealth creation is necessary over a sustained period of two generations before genius is ‘affordable’ and therefore emerges because a sufficient number of people have the time and resources to specialize in what is essentially non productive labor. 

    4). We have argued for a few generations now that it appears to take five to seven hundred years for a civilization to ‘cook’ a philosopher.  And that civilizations appear to go thru phases that produce different categories of thinkers in each season.

    5) These factors suggest a causal relation that other commenters attribute to sheer temporal correlation.  That is: it’s very expensive to get enough IQ available and working on intellectual production, over enough generations, that minor insights can accumulate in sufficient numbers that someone from a following generation can synthesize and articulate the common causal relations between those insights and articulate that common causal relation as a new “idea”.

    I’d recommend Murray’s tome Human Accomplishment and Joel Mokyr’s various works including The Gifts of Athena.

  • NOTES ON MATHEMATICAL PHILOSOPHY “…Mathematics is an established, going concern.

    NOTES ON MATHEMATICAL PHILOSOPHY

    “…Mathematics is an established, going concern. Philosophy is as shaky

    as can be.”

    CD: This seems quaint, as it is meant to seem quaint by the author to illustrate the point. However, the problem of philosophy is one of “intermediacy”, rather than ends. To incorporate new discoveries and ideas into our system of thought. To develop some means of conceptual commensurability. WHile in the past, all domains were at some point parts of philosophy, the success of philosophy has been at casting off those domains. At present, the only remaining domain philosophy addresses is that of the commensurable integration of knew ideas into our body of knowledge. For this reason, philosophy, like money in the calculation plans, makes the moral and ethical world of action commensurable despite the disciplinary differences in method and goal. It may be that all philosophy does is protect us from catastrophic errors that may cause us harm, rather than provide any particular innovation. But the works of Aristotle, Machiavelli, Smith, Hume, Jefferson and Darwin are evidence enough that at times, our entire systems of thought must be reordered, and new values attached to causes and consequences. Or by contrast, Voltaire, Rousseau, Kant, Marx, Freud, Heidegger and Rorty, who have tried to do the opposite: To restore immoral obscurantism as a revolt against modern empirical thought.

    “One of the most important forms of revisionism in philosophy of mathematics of the latter part of 20th century has been extreme (strict) formalism (nominalism), and its ontological conclusion, Hartry Field’s (1980) fictionalism. According to it mathematical objects do not exist, and the formal axiomatic systems that form the core of mathematics do not refer to anything outside them. In other words, for the extreme formalist rules of proof and axioms

    are all there is to mathematics.”



    “One main purpose of this work is to show that we do not. In this work that is called the problem of theory choice, and I will try to show it to be the most fundamental problem with strict formalist philosophy of mathematics. Simply put, I will argue that when taken to its logical conclusion, extreme formalism implies completely arbitrary mathematics: we would have no reason to prefer one set of axioms and rules of proof over another. That is a staggering conclusion, but we will see it is the only one that can be plausibly made if we reject all outer reference from mathematics. Fortunately it never comes to that, since mathematics without any outer reference does not make sense. We need to explain why we prefer some rules of proof and some axioms to others, and without any concept of reference this cannot be done. In this work I will argue that without any outer reference, mathematics as we know it could simply not be possible: it could not have developed, and it could not be learnt or practised. Sophisticated formal theories are the pinnacle of mathematics but, philosophically, they cannot be studied separately from all the non-formal background behind them.”

    CD: Agreed. It is impossible to escape correspondence between method and reality. But lets see where the author takes this…
